Start your child's journey with confidence and prepare for an exciting start at our private school in Pembroke Pines.
Submit an inquiry
Begin your journey by completing our online inquiry form. This quick step helps you to share key information about your family and allows our admissions team to connect with you.
Tour our facilities
Schedule a private, personalized tour to explore our classrooms, meet our team, and see our Montessori approach in action. This visit helps us get to know your family and gives you a clear, first-hand understanding of our programs.
Submit your application
After your tour, you will receive an online application form. Please complete all forms, attach any required documents, and submit the application. Checking every item on the application checklist helps us review your child’s file efficiently and avoid delays.
Interview and admissions exam
Our Admissions office will schedule an evaluation. For younger children, we consider their ability to adapt to the Montessori environment, while students in Elementary and Middle School take part in an entrance exam.
Offer and acceptance
Your child’s completed file is reviewed by our administrative team and parents of admitted students pay a non-refundable enrollment fee, which officially accepts the offer and secures their spot. Fee amounts vary by age and grade level.
Welcome to Montessori Academy of Broward
Our admissions team will send you a confirmation with the next steps and any remaining forms to complete. Once everything is finalized, your child is officially enrolled and warmly welcomed into the Montessori Academy of Broward community.
